Summary


The Technician II - Electrician responsibilities include but are not limited to electronics troubleshooting and the setup, maintenance and repair of complex production equipment without direct supervision as well as assigning work Factory Hourly Operators, Tech I.     
 

  • Essential Functions
  • ·         Work in various departments following the applicable Skill Set Grouping (SSG).
  • ·         Provide electronics troubleshooting
  • ·         Plan and perform electrical/ electronic installations
  • ·         Maintenance and repair of all types of machines, controls and facilities
  • ·         Read and work with wiring diagrams, schematics and special instructions
  • ·         Perform work in accordance of National Electrical Code
  • ·         Set up computer controlled equipment without supervision
  • ·         Perform programming of computer controlled equipment
  • ·         Assign work to Operators under the direction of the supervisor as required.
  • ·         Accurately account for finished production and record material consumption.
  • ·         Repair production equipment, perform routine maintenance, and assist in the      installation or relocation of equipment.
  • ·         Perform complex material requirement calculations to insure the proper amount of material is utilized in the manufacturing process.
  • ·         Perform construction of piping, fixtures, move equipment, and other construction duties as assigned.
  • ·         May be responsible for oversight and supervision of Operator I, Operator II and Tech I personnel
  • ·         The complexities of duties performed by a Tech II are those duties for which proficiency would be expected after 24-36 months of training and hands on experience.
